Holi and Summer Super Fast Special Train between Indore – Gandhinagar (Train No. 09310 / 09309) time table, route, frequency and fare
For the convenience of passengers and with a view to meet the travel demand, Western Railway has decided to run Indore – Gandhinagar
Train No. 09310 Indore Jn – Gandhinagar Capital Special will depart from Indore Jn at 23.00 hrs every day and will reach Gandhinagar Capital at 09.45 hrs, the next day w.e.f. 1st March, 2025 till further advice.
Similarly, Train No. 09309 Gandhinagar Capital – Indore Jn Special will depart from Gandhinagar Capital at 18.15 hrs every day and will reach Indore Jn at 05.55 hrs, the next day w.e.f. 2nd March, 2025 till further advice.
The train will halt at Dewas, Ujjain, Nagda, Khachrod, Ratlam, Meghnagar, Dahod, Godhra, Chhayapuri, Anand, Nadiad, Mahemadavad Kheda Rd, Ahmedabad, Sabarmati and Chandlodiya stations in both directions.
The train comprises of AC 2-Tier, AC 3-Tier, Sleeper Class and Second Class seating coaches.
